JOB SUMMARY: Under the direction of the Supervisor of Special Education the Special Education Teacher Specialist will support special education students in Caroline County Public Schools. The Special Education Teacher Specialist works directly with special education teachers across the district to support high quality developmentally appropriate instructional practices in classrooms. This position also involves developing and delivering professional development opportunities and sustaining curriculum practices that foster innovation and high quality learning experiences. The Special Education Teacher Specialist functions as an instructional colleague is not part of school administration and does not participate in the evaluation of teacher performance.
QUALIFICATIONS:
- Valid Maryland Teaching Certificate in Special Education.
- At least three (3) years of successful teaching experience.
- Demonstrate evidence of leadership ability.
- Demonstrate effective interpersonal and communication skills.
- Knowledge and experience in specially designed instruction behavior support special education compliance (IDEA/COMAR) and MTSS.
- Experience in assessment administration data collection progress monitoring and analysis.
- Ability to work with an ethnically and educationally diverse group of students parents and school staff.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:
- Ensures compliance with all applicable local state and/or federal regulations.
- Establishes procedures timetables forms recordkeeping procedures and other administrative tools required for the efficient operation of the school and districts special education program.
- Assists in all aspects of the IEP process including facilitating an IEP Team and/or Student Assistant Team meeting and the development of standardsbased IEPs.
- Coaches special education teachers on highleverage practices to help narrow the achievement gap including specially designed instruction coteaching and effective uses of technology.
- Monitors program effectiveness by gathering manipulating and analyzing assessment results at the school level and provides support to teachers as needed.
- Provides accurate program evaluation information and reports as requested by the Supervisor of Special Education Coordinators of Special Education and/or the principal.
- Plan/Implement/Coordinate Professional Development opportunities including but not limited to: specially designed instruction progress monitoring writing standardsbased IEPs and behavior supports.
- Provide technical assistance to staff in all areas related to creating specially designed instruction behavior support coteaching progress monitoring and MTSS.
- Provide consultation and best practices in coteaching service delivery models specially designed instruction data collection and classroom management.
- Models highquality instruction to students who are at risk in reading writing or math.
- Accepts other duties as may be assigned which are related to the scope of the job.
